Is there a way to have a message box appear on the screen
that will assume an "OK" response after a timed interval in the absence of the user pressing "OK". Thank you. |
Message box
No.
You can simulate this by using a user form which looks like a message box and put a timer control on it which will close the form should no input be forthcoming. -- Regards, Bill Lunney www.billlunney.com "Isy Taman" wrote in message ...
